Daring to Dream takes the reader through a year in the author's life - a year of rebirth following the end of a 32-year marriage - into those private moments of anguish and reflection where we discover that we have the strength, wisdom and power to grow from life's most challenging experiences. "It is about a year in time, a year when I lived on the top of a mountain in near total silence and found myself. It was a year of sadness and loss but, more importantly, it was a year of incredible magic." Karen Ely's journey toward an authentic life and a stronger sense of herself is both heartbreaking and exhilarating. Her honesty reaches out invitingly, encouraging all women to turn their attention inward and listen to the beatings of their own hearts.

About the Author:
KAREN ELY’s thirty year career in non-profit management -- from domestic violence and sexual assault to drug prevention and welfare-to-work -- has helped assist thousands of women through difficult life transitions. In 2003 Karen fulfilled a lifelong dream of creating a women's spiritual retreat program. Located in Sedona, Arizona, A Woman's Way is her latest project in a life filled with commitment to issues affecting women. It is her hope that this book and A Woman's Way will benefit other women searching for a spiritual center and a path to finding themselves, for she believes that it is the ultimate journey.
